Dover is an AI-powered recruiting platform designed for startups. It combines a free Applicant Tracking System (ATS) with a marketplace of expert fractional recruiters. Dover automates sourcing, screening, and scheduling to help companies hire top talent faster and more efficiently, saving valuable time for founders and hiring managers.
Noon is an autonomous AI talent sourcer that acts as a dedicated teammate for recruiting teams. It automates the entire end-to-end sourcing process, from understanding job requirements and searching for candidates across the web to engaging them with personalized, multi-channel campaigns, helping you hire top talent faster.
